LBS expert handed new award for case writing excellence
Jérémie Gallien wins case writing category at ecch Case Awards
Jérémie Gallien, Associate Professor of Management Science and Operations, London Business School, has won the new case writer category at the 2012 ecch Case Awards Competition. The ecch Case Awards recognises excellent case writing worldwide and raises the profile of the case method of learning.
The award-winning case study, Massachusetts General Hospital's Pre-Admission Testing Area, was co-authored by Dr. Gallien, Kelsey McCarty of Massachusetts General Hospital and Retsef Levi of MIT Sloan School of Management.
The competition attracted entries of 64 cases from 57 institutions in 27 countries. His research focused on the pre-admissions testing area, which is an outpatient clinic at Massachusetts General Hospital, responsible for conducting pre-operative assessments of surgical patients prior to their procedures.
This case study exposes students to concrete operational challenges in health care delivery and illustrates the application and potential benefits of quantitative process analysis and process reengineering in this environment.
